Title: Undo/redo corrupts connector anchors in Sketchline

Steps: create two nodes, link them, move node B, undo twice, redo once. Connector reattaches to the wrong anchor point and cannot be dragged afterward. Repro rate roughly 80% on the Meridian test boards. Affects Sketchline 3.1 and later; 3.0 appears clean. Workaround for callers: save, reload the diagram, redo history is lost but geometry recovers. Escalate anything involving grouped nodes. The affected build token follows.

trace token, fafof-tajef: htk9_849b0fd88

Ticket: Config drift on the Haldane garage occupancy feed. The Ostermill node is publishing counts every 5s while the other three garages publish every 15s, which skews the aggregation window downstream in Lotgrid. Someone hot-patched the interval during the holiday surge and never reverted. Please review the diff and restore parity across all nodes. The intended baseline configuration is as follows.

settings of kahip-hafop:
ralix:
  log_level: warn
  metrics_host: metrics.ralix.zemvarsys.internal
  pin: 8273
  pool_size: 8

Quick orientation on the Invigil proctoring queue before the sync. Exams land in the queue when the flagging model scores above threshold; reviewers claim items oldest-first. SLA is 4 hours during term weeks. Never requeue an item you've opened — escalate to the queue lead instead. Staffing rotations are owned by the Margate pod. The queue dashboard, claim rules, and escalation flow are documented here.

wiki page, tahaf-tajog: https://jira.ordindyn.corp/pipeline

## Environment Variables — Consent Banner Rollout

This page documents the variables governing the Glimmerbay consent banner rollout. `CONSENT_BANNER_ENABLED` gates rendering per region, while `CONSENT_ROLLOUT_PERCENT` controls the gradual ramp (start at 5, increase in 10-point steps only after legal sign-off). Release managers must verify both values in the canary environment before promoting. Finally, the consent-ledger service authenticates against the audit store using a credential that must appear on the next line of the environment file:

sealed setting: VAULT_KEY20=c8ea1e419912889df6b4